I’ve encountered an issue with Direct Messages (DMs) in my Discourse forum and would appreciate some guidance.
Problem Description
Sometimes when another user sends me a direct message:
I correctly receive a browser push notification.
However, the chat icon in the top navigation bar does not display any badge count (e.g., “1”).
To see the new message, I have to manually click on the chat icon and open the conversation.
This issue does not happen consistently—it occurs intermittently.
Environment and Details
Discourse version: Latest stable release
Browser: Microsoft Edge (latest version) on Windows 10
Plugins: No plugins installed that affect chat or notifications
Multiple devices: I am logged into my account on several devices
Observed pattern:
On one occasion, I received a new DM but the chat icon did not show any badge.
When I logged in with another account and sent myself a test message from a different browser, the chat icon suddenly updated and displayed the correct badge count for both messages (the earlier one and the new one).
The user whose message did not trigger the badge was a newly registered account (only a few hours old). I am not sure if this is related.
Attachments
I’ve attached screenshots showing the notification behavior and my settings for clarity.
Expected Behavior
Whenever I receive a new DM, I expect the chat icon to always display the correct badge count, regardless of whether the sender is a newly registered user or whether I’m logged in on multiple devices.
Is this a known bug, or could it be related to a specific configuration?
